definitionthe teacher leads students toward the fulfillment of their potential for intellectual, emotional, and psychological growth and maturation.
key functionsa.
student learning: teachers understand student learning and development, and respect the diversity of the students they teach.
- displays knowledge of how students learn and of the developmental characteristics of age groups.
- understands what students know and are able to do and use this knowledge to meet the needs of all students.
- expects that all students will achieve to their full potential.
- models respect for students' diverse cultures, language skills and experiences.
- recognizes characteristics of gifted students, students with disabilities and at-risk students in order to assist in appropriate identification, instruction, and intervention.
b.
content knowledge: teachers know and understand the content area for which they have instructional responsibility.
- knows the content they teach and use their knowledge of content-specific concepts, assumptions and skills to plan instruction.
- understands and uses content-specific instructional strategies to effectively teach the central concepts and skills of the discipline.
- understands school and district curriculum priorities and the ohio academic content standards.
- understands the relationship of knowledge within the content area to other content areas.
- connects content to relevant life experiences and career opportunities.
c.
assessment: teachers understand and use varied assessments to inform instruction, evaluate and ensure student learning.
- is knowledgeable about assessment types, their purposes and the data they generate.
- selects, develops and uses variety of diagnostic, formative and summative assessments.
- analyzes data to monitor student progress and learning to plan, differentiate and modify instruction
- collaborates and communicates student progress with students, parents and colleagues
- involves learners in self-assessment and goal setting to address gaps between performance and potential.
d.
delivery of instruction: teachers plan and deliver effective instruction that advances the learning of each individual student.
- aligns his/her instructional goals and activities with school and district priorities and ohio's academic content standards.
- uses information about students' learning and performance to plan and deliver instruction that will close the achievement gap
- communicates clear learning goals and explicitly link learning activities to those defined goals.
- applies knowledge of how students think and learn to instructional design and delivery.
- differentiates instruction to support the learning needs of all students, including students identified as gifted, students with disabilities and at-risk students.
- creates and selects activities that are designed to help students develop as independent learners and complex problem-solvers.
- uses resources effectively, including technology, to enhance student learning.
e.
learning environment: teachers create learning environments that promote high levels of learning and achievement for all students.
- treats all students fairly and establish an environment that is respectful, supportive and caring.
- creates an environment that is physically and emotionally safe.
- motivates students to work productively and assume responsibility for their own learning.
- creates learning situations in which students work independently, collaboratively and/or as a whole class.
- maintains an environment that is conducive to learning for all students.
f.
collaboration: teachers collaborate and communicate with other educators, administrators, students and parents and the community to support student learning.
- communicates clearly and effectively.
- shares responsibility with parents and caregivers to support student learning, emotional and physical development and mental health.
- collaborates effectively with other teachers, administrators and school and district staff.
- collaborates effectively with the local community and community agencies, when and where appropriate, to promote a positive environment for student learning.
g.
professional growth: teachers assume responsibility for professional growth, performance, and involvement as an individual and as a member of a learning community.
- understands, upholds and follows professional ethics, policies and legal codes of professional conduct.
- takes responsibility for engaging in continuous, purposeful professional development.
- is an agent of change who seeks opportunities to positively impact teaching quality, school improvements and student achievement.
- is willing to share professional development with colleagues
